At least 88 homes were damaged when heavy downpours hit Hospital Hills in Lenasia.

facebook: Gift of the Givers

“Residents are piecing their lives together. They are helping with rebuilding homes and cleaning up houses after heavy rain on Thursday night,” Nzimande said on Sunday.“We sent immediate needs like blankets, hygiene packs and hot meals on Saturday and we are going back on Monday to give affected families food parcels and clothing,” Mohamed said.Image:She said they also helped affected families with cleaning up their homes.
